CORPUS CHRISTI – Senior Ryann White and sophomore Micah Nolan have been named the GoIslanders.com Student-Athletes of the Week, presented by Pepsi. White and Nolan have earned the award for their recording breaking performances.
White matched the school record and shot the low round of her collegiate career, a 69, in the second round of the Harold Funston Invitational on Tuesday, Oct. 11. White's impressive second round led her to a second-place finish at the event, as she finished one shot off the title. She posted a 73 in the opening round of the event to deliver a two-round 142 in the rain-shortened event.
Nolan set an Islanders single-match record with 39 digs against the Nicholls Colonels to help lead her team to the win on Thursday. Nolan added an additional 12 digs in her team's 3-0 sweep over Southeastern La. on Saturday. For the week, she totaled 62 digs in 11 sets for a 5.64 digs per set average. Additionally, the sophomore added three service aces, seven assists and three kills as the Islanders finished the week 2-1.
